What is recorded here
In undulating grassland. Marked on 3rd ed. of OS 6-inch map (1946) as a circular enclosure (D c. 30m). No visible surface trace survives.
The above description is derived from the published 'Archaeological Inventory of County Galway Vol. II - North Galway'. Compiled by Olive Alcock, Kathy de hÓra and Paul Gosling (Dublin: Stationery Office, 1999).
